You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

如何在路由器结束时清除LRUCache的缓存?

首先,LRUCache是一个基于LRU(最近最少使用)算法的缓存库。要清除LRUCache的缓存,可以调用其clear()方法。

在Camel中,可以在路由结束的时候使用onCompletion()来触发清除LRUCache的缓存操作。具体实现代码如下:

from("direct:start")
    .routeId("myRoute")
    .to("lrucache://myCache?maxEntries=1000")
    .onCompletion()
        .log("Clearing LRUCache")
        .to("lrucache://myCache?clear=true")
    .end()
    .to("direct:end");

上述代码中,lrucache://myCache表示使用名称为"myCache"的LRUCache,设置最大条目数为1000。onCompletion()方法用于在路由结束时进行清除操作,清除方法为to("lrucache://myCache?clear=true")。

这样,在路由结束时就会自动清除LRUCache的缓存,以便下一次使用。

本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。
展开更多
面向开发者的云福利中心,ECS 60元/年,域名1元起,助力开发者快速在云上构建可靠应用

社区干货

一口气看完43个关于 ElasticSearch 的使用建议

(NodeQueryCache /Filter Cache)**Lucene 层面的缓存实现,封装在 LRUQueryCache 类中,默认开启。缓存的是某个 Filter 子查询语句在一个 Segment 上的查询结果。并非所有的 Filter 查询都会被缓存。对于体积较小的 Segment 不会建立 Query Cache,因为他们很快会被合并。Segment 的 Doc 数量需要大于 10000,并且占整个分片的 3% 以上才会走 Cache 策略(参考:缓存)。当 Segment 合并的时候,被删除的 Segment 其关联 Cache 会失...

分布式数据库在抖音春晚活动中的应用

数据模型:首先肯定会有一个基于page/block组织的 LRU cache;还会有基于 page 组织的一个树状结构,用来组织数据、索引等;还有一个 global log buffer,或者可能也会实现成一个 thread local 的 log buffer用于下刷日... 可化解多事务并发时候的 global lock 瓶颈,提高了多事务并发能力。- 融合了 redo log 和 Binlog。目的是消除原生的 binlog 和 redolog XA 机制带来的一些问题,同时融合成单流之后也能提高写入性能。## 分布式...

分布式数据库在抖音春晚活动中的应用

数据模型:首先肯定会有一个基于 page/block 组织的 LRU cache;还会有基于 page 组织的一个树状结构,用来组织数据、索引等;还有一个 global log buffer,或者可能也会实现成一个 thread local 的 log buffer 用于下刷... 可化解多事务并发时候的 global lock 瓶颈,提高了多事务并发能力。* 融合了 redo log 和 Binlog。目的是消除原生的 binlog 和 redolog XA 机制带来的一些问题,同时融合成单流之后也能提高写入性能。**分布式...

如何排查 Redis 集群提示“当所用内存大于 'maxmemory' 时不允许 OOM 命令”报错问题

缓存数据库 Redis 集群无法释放任何额外内存时,会发生 OOM 错误。内存不足时,缓存数据库 Redis 会实施数据节点的参数配置的策略 **maxmemory-policy**。默认值 **(volatile-lru)** 会移出设置了过期时间的键(TTL ... 即从设置了过期时间的键中选出存活时间(TTL)最短的键进行删除,从而腾出空间。#### 2. 更新参数配置以使用其他 maxmemory-policy 设置。将 Redis 实例**参数配置**的 **maxmemory-policy** 设置为以下其中一个值:...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

如何在路由器结束时清除LRUCache的缓存? -优选内容

一口气看完43个关于 ElasticSearch 的使用建议
(NodeQueryCache /Filter Cache)**Lucene 层面的缓存实现,封装在 LRUQueryCache 类中,默认开启。缓存的是某个 Filter 子查询语句在一个 Segment 上的查询结果。并非所有的 Filter 查询都会被缓存。对于体积较小的 Segment 不会建立 Query Cache,因为他们很快会被合并。Segment 的 Doc 数量需要大于 10000,并且占整个分片的 3% 以上才会走 Cache 策略(参考:缓存)。当 Segment 合并的时候,被删除的 Segment 其关联 Cache 会失...
功能接入
默认无限制cacheConfig.enableLRU = YES; //LRU 启用[BDImageCache sharedImageCache].config = cacheConfig;BDImageCache *cache = [BDImageCache sharedImageCache];cache.totalDiskSize;//同步获取磁盘缓存的所有数据的字节数[cache trimDiskCache];//同步根据设置的最大磁盘大小,对象数量和过期时间,清除过期的缓存[cache clearMemory];//清除内存缓存中的所有数据[cache clearDiskWithBlock:^{ // 清除磁盘缓存中的所有数据...
分布式数据库在抖音春晚活动中的应用
数据模型:首先肯定会有一个基于page/block组织的 LRU cache;还会有基于 page 组织的一个树状结构,用来组织数据、索引等;还有一个 global log buffer,或者可能也会实现成一个 thread local 的 log buffer用于下刷日... 可化解多事务并发时候的 global lock 瓶颈,提高了多事务并发能力。- 融合了 redo log 和 Binlog。目的是消除原生的 binlog 和 redolog XA 机制带来的一些问题,同时融合成单流之后也能提高写入性能。## 分布式...
分布式数据库在抖音春晚活动中的应用
数据模型:首先肯定会有一个基于 page/block 组织的 LRU cache;还会有基于 page 组织的一个树状结构,用来组织数据、索引等;还有一个 global log buffer,或者可能也会实现成一个 thread local 的 log buffer 用于下刷... 可化解多事务并发时候的 global lock 瓶颈,提高了多事务并发能力。* 融合了 redo log 和 Binlog。目的是消除原生的 binlog 和 redolog XA 机制带来的一些问题,同时融合成单流之后也能提高写入性能。**分布式...

如何在路由器结束时清除LRUCache的缓存? -相关内容

API 详情

视频总时长,单位为秒。 playableDurationobjectivec @property (nonatomic, assign, readonly) NSTimeInterval playableDuration;当前可播放时长,即缓存进度,单位为秒。 durationWatchedobjectivec @property (n... 停止播放。 closeobjectivec - (void)close;关闭销毁播放器。 注意 销毁播放器实例后,不能再调用任何方法。您可以将 engine 实例设置为 nil,防止再次调用。 closeAysncobjectivec -(void)closeAysnc;异步关闭销毁...

veImageX 演进之路:iOS 高性能图片加载 SDK

它使用 YYCache 支持内存和磁盘缓存,使用 YYImage 支持 WebP/APNG/GIF 图片解码,但可惜的是此优秀的框架于 2017 年左右已停止更新; - SDWebImage:目前使用较广泛的一个图片处理框架,可以异步加载网络图片,... 就可以解决图片的时效性问题。 内存缓存方面除了支持 iOS 原生的 NSCache 外,还支持 Strong-Weak 的弱引用缓存,当缓存对象无人持有时会被及时释放掉,降低内存占用,同时也支持 LRU 缓存。在收到内存不足的通知...

如何排查 RDS for MySQL 内存占用问题

二进制日志 **binlog_cache_size**,插入缓存 **bulk_insert_buffer_size**,临时表 **tmp_table_size**,**query_cache_siz**等。- 全局共享内存参数的配置:表缓存 **table_open_cache**,连接线程 **thread_cache_... 在还没有被读取到的时候,被踢出了buffer pool,如果这个值持续走高,我们就需要增大缓冲池了LRU len: 584, unzip_LRU len: 0I/O sum[0]:cur[0], unzip sum[0]:cur[0]```## 最佳实践- 通过将大型查询分解为多个...

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

如何排查RDS for MySQL 内存占用问题

二进制日志 **binlog_cache_size**,插入缓存 **bulk_insert_buffer_size**,临时表 **tmp_table_size**,**query_cache_siz**等。* 全局共享内存参数的配置:表缓存 **table_open_cache**,连接线程 **thread_cache_s... 在还没有被读取到的时候,被踢出了buffer pool,如果这个值持续走高,我们就需要增大缓冲池了LRU len: 584, unzip_LRU len: 0I/O sum[0]:cur[0], unzip sum[0]:cur[0]```## 最佳实践* 通过将大型查询分解为多个...

混合专家语言的快速推理的大模型 |社区征文

主要目标是在桌面级硬件上使用 Mixtral-8x7BInstruct(一个基于 MoE 的聊天助手)进行推理(生成令牌),其中只有一小部分专家适合加速器内存。为此:观察 MoE 语言模型如何在标记之间访问其专家,并发现几个规律性,一些 EA 在相邻的代币之间重复使用,模型被隐藏早期层的状态已经“知道”哪些专家将在后续层中使用。设计了一个特定于教育部的卸载策略,该策略利用了以下规律性:它使用 LRU 缓存来显着减少 GPU-RAM 通信,从而加快速度生成和...

API 详情

clearAllStrategyjava public static void com.ss.ttvideoengine.TTVideoEngine.clearAllStrategy()清除所有策略,释放资源。 注意 在退出当前页面或切换到其他页面时调用此方法。 addTaskjava public static vo... clearAllCachesjava public static void com.ss.ttvideoengine.TTVideoEngine.clearAllCaches()删除所有数据加载模块的缓存数据。 注意 此方法不全部删除所有缓存数据,而是会按照 Least Recently Used (LRU) 算法...

技术新风向丨挖掘藏在小程序 Cookie 里的秘密

下面为大家详细地介绍以下这两种流行方式!## 手动管理 Cookie> 使用小程序[数据缓存](https://developer.open-douyin.com/docs/resource/zh-CN/mini-app/develop/api/data-caching/tt-get-storage/)能力模拟 Co... 宿主账号切换会清空 Cookie 数据。**Q2:Cookie 对数量、大小是否有限制?**A2:每个小程序**每个域名下最多 50 个 Cookie**,**总 Cookie 不超过1000个**,如超过限制使用 LRU 算法淘汰。**每个 Cookie 大小不超过...

一文读懂火山引擎云数据库产品及选型

例如作为关系型数据库的外部缓存,用于提升系统整体的读性能,减轻关系型数据库的读压力。文档型 NoSQL 数据库使用的是一种半结构化的数据模型(json 或 xml 格式),与关系型数据库相比,文档型 NoSQL 是没有 Schema... 帮助您在云上轻松、快速地构建 Redis 数据库。缓存数据库 Redis 提供了高性能且安全的 Redis 数据库解决方案,按需计费结合动态扩展能力能够显著地帮助企业降低成本,同时也有助于消除管理、运维数据库的复杂性。...

设置 Key 的过期驱逐策略

您可以在控制台上通过设置 maxmemory-policy 参数设置 Key 的过期驱逐策略。 过期策略说明作为一个内存数据库,Redis 在内存空间不足的时候,为了保证命中率,就会选择一定的数据淘汰策略,可选的过期策略说明如下: volatile-lru(默认值):只从设置失效(expire set)的键中选择最近最少使用的键进行删除。 volatile-lfu:只从设置失效(expire set)的键中选择最不常用的键进行删除。 volatile-random:只从设置失效(expire set)的键中,随机...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

产品体验

体验中心

云服务器特惠

云服务器
云服务器ECS新人特惠
立即抢购

白皮书

一图详解大模型
浓缩大模型架构,厘清生产和应用链路关系
立即获取

最新活动

爆款1核2G共享型服务器

首年60元,每月仅需5元,限量秒杀
立即抢购

火山引擎增长体验专区

丰富能力激励企业快速增长
查看详情

数据智能VeDI

易用的高性能大数据产品家族
了解详情

一键开启云上增长新空间

立即咨询